MN: Possible Milan XI for Feyenoord repeat – Terrific Trio hope for additional redemption

AC Milan have an enormous check tomorrow night at San Siro. Because it stands, Feyenoord will progress within the Champions League and the Rossoneri should change their tune.

Issues haven’t gone to plan in Europe lately. Regardless of a superb opening, Milan at the moment are in actual hazard of bowing out of the competitors to Dutch facet Feyenoord, which everyone seems to be eager to keep away from, particularly the administration.

As experiences, a two-goal swing is required, and Sergio Conceicao is taking a calculated threat to attempt to get a outcome.

In assault, the ‘Fab 4’ will turn out to be the Terrific Trio, as Christian Pulisic is about to overlook out from the beginning. Whereas , he’s not totally match so is not going to begin, so Yunus Musah will take his place on the proper of a 4-4-2.

Santiago Gimenez and Joao Felix will lead the road with Rafael Leao supporting from the left.

In central midfield, Conceicao is about to depend on his two fundamental males as soon as once more – Youssouf Fofana and Tijjani Reijnders, although this might imply that the system is barely completely different – maybe a 4-2-3-1 with the Dutchman behind Gimenez.

Defensively there will likely be no adjustments to Conceicao’s superb again 4, so we’ll see the return of the Fikayo Tomori and Strahinja Pavlovic pairing.

Predicted Milan XI (4-4-2): Maignan; Walker, Pavlovic, Tomori, Theo; Musah, Fofana, Reijners, Leao; Gimenez, Felix.
